Note that the wizard cards, like the room cards that I featured in the last update, are expanded to include spaces for the enemy figures. This also allows more room for text, which is slightly larger for readability. 

Next, here's a sample enemy card for Cursed Library. 

As in the base game, the various room cards describe the enemies present on the floor. In the Cursed Library expansion, these enemies are books. Once defeated, the card is set aside and flipped to its character side. Here it may be purchased by a hero for its ink price. Character cards may used as skills to assist the players, but any damage taken is assigned to the characters!

This yellow enemy is the Big Bad Wolf, and has 6 health. The flying saucer indicates the genre. Many hero skills have affect enemies or characters of certain genres. The player defeating the BBW gains one ink and the card is flipped to the character side, Red Riding Hood.

Someone asked to see some of the component changes. You asked for more art on the skill cards, so we added the hero to each card. This means that the hero cards (in the base game) will be double-sided - one side with the male hero and the other with the female hero art.

We also changed the room cards, which are now almost twice the size, and contain space to easily add the enemy figures.

  • The new hero class, the Seer has some interesting traits. First, she has a line of Flying Supernal skills that get more powerful, the more she has. The catch is that these skills require hero colors that she doesn't drop. So she either needs to use luck points or have another player help to set her up. Higher level versions of Flying Supernal skills can even pull enemy cubes from the field!
  • The wizard we created is Eigenstein, the Austrian Illusionist. Eigenstein raised the spirit sisters Rita and Delores (described in the last update, who became the new mid-bosses), and is a formidable opponent. Any cubes that fall into the crypt are considered black cubes, and black cubes add daemons to the board. Not only do daemons do a lot of damage to the party, but they also add more black cubes to the field!
